Upcoming Programs and Activities for SECURITY MEASURE Recreation, Parks, IMPLEMENTED and Libraries AT RECREATION CENTER New security measures were implemented at the Kent County Recreation Center in November 2018. All evening and weekend activity participants and spectators will be subject to advanced security screening when entering the facility. An armed security guard will screen incoming guests Winter with a walk through metal detector/wand 2018-19 and x-ray machine for bags and backpacks. DROP INOFFERED PROGRAMS AT THE REC CENTER

Kent County Parks and Recreation offers drop in programs such as Pickleball, Youth, Adult and 40+ Basketball and Volleyball. In order to participate in these programs you would need to purchase a $10 punch card (good for 10 drop in sessions).

TO CHECK OUT TIMES OF PLAY, PLEASE VIEW THE SCHEDULE ON FACEBOOK OR THE WEBSITE.

22 ❄ Kent County Levy Court Winter 2018 WINTER PROGRAMS AT THE HOWELL MILL NATURE CENTER

The Howell Mill Nature Center is tucked into the trees at Brecknock Park in Camden, DE. Originally a granary for the working mill, this historic and rural building has been transformed into a center for historical and environmental education. The Nature Center is open on the second Saturday of each month from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. ALL PROGRAMS ARE FREE TO THE PUBLIC. For group programs and tours, please contact (302) 744 – 2495.

All programs are free and open to the public (except where noted differently), and will be held at the library located at 497 S. Red Haven Lane, Dover. Many of our programs do require preregistration due to limited space. Stop by the circulation desk or call us at (302) 744-1919 to preregister. You can also register online at www.tinyurl.com/KCPLcalendar. It is the policy of the Kent County Levy Court that all programs be accessible to all qualified handicapped individuals as provided in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973. If you or the person(s) you are registering need reasonable accommodation for your program of interest, please contact the Kent County Library before registering to discuss the matter with the program coordinator(s). The Library may photograph programs and participants for publicity purposes, including posting to social media sites.
